Veranda Sealing in Gig Harbor, WA
Veranda sealing services involve applying protective coatings to outdoor porch and deck surfaces to help preserve their appearance and structural integrity. This process typically covers wood, composite, or concrete verandas, providing a barrier against moisture, UV rays, and other environmental elements that can cause damage over time. Homeowners often seek veranda sealing to extend the lifespan of their outdoor spaces, prevent warping or cracking, and maintain a clean, attractive look for their property.
Before requesting veranda sealing, property owners usually want to understand the condition of their existing surface, including any necessary repairs or cleaning prior to sealing. It’s also helpful to know the types of sealants used and how they will impact the appearance and durability of the veranda. Clarifying the scope of the project and any specific concerns about weather exposure or ongoing maintenance can ensure the sealing process meets long-term needs.

Veranda Sealing Questions
What is veranda sealing? Veranda sealing involves applying a protective coating to the surface to prevent damage from moisture, UV rays, and wear, helping to extend its lifespan.
When should a veranda be sealed? Sealing is recommended when the surface shows signs of wear, such as fading or cracking, or as part of regular maintenance to preserve its appearance and durability.
What types of materials can be sealed on a veranda? Common materials include wood, composite decking, and concrete surfaces, all of which benefit from sealing to protect against weathering.
How often should a veranda be resealed? Typically, resealing is advised every one to three years, depending on the material and exposure to the elements.
